1- Higher Efficiency : Smarter and More Cost-Effective LED Lighting
Energy efficiency remains the primary factor for choosing lighting solutions in 2026. Modern LED lights provide:
- Up to 80% lower energy consumption compared to traditional incandescent or fluorescent bulbs.
- Extended lifespans of up to 100,000 hours, reducing maintenance and replacement costs.
- Dynamic lighting control that adjusts brightness automatically based on occupancy or natural light levels, maximizing efficiency without compromising comfort.
These features give businesses and commercial buildings a competitive advantage, especially as energy costs rise and sustainability regulations tighten globally.
2- Smart LED Lighting and Building Automation
Integrating LED lighting with smart building systems (BMS) is one of the most significant trends in 2026:
- Remote control through mobile apps or voice commands.
- Automated on/off schedules based on occupancy and activity.
- Integration with motion sensors and ambient light sensors for optimal energy use.
- Compatibility with renewable energy systems like solar panels and battery storage to increase sustainability.
Smart LED lighting is no longer optional—it’s a necessity for modern offices, hotels, hospitals, and commercial complexes.
3- Sustainability and Environmental Responsibility
By 2026, LED adoption is driven not only by performance but also by environmental responsibility:
- Reduced carbon emissions due to lower energy consumption.
- Use of eco-friendly manufacturing materials.
- Minimization of waste due to the long lifespan of LED lights.
Recent studies show that full adoption of LED lighting can reduce energy consumption in commercial buildings by over 50%, supporting global sustainability goals and green building certifications.
4- Enhanced Light Quality and Visual Experience
LED technology in 2026 emphasizes visual comfort and high-quality illumination:
- High Color Rendering Index (CRI >90) ensures accurate color representation, ideal for retail, galleries, and office environments.
- Uniform light distribution reduces glare and shadows.
- Multiple color temperatures (3000K–6500K) allow customization for different applications, from offices to industrial facilities.
These improvements make LED lighting the ideal choice for spaces requiring precise color accuracy and superior visual comfort.
5- LED Market Trends in 2026
The global LED market is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) exceeding 10% over the next few years, driven by :
- The rise of smart buildings and smart cities.
- Increasing awareness of sustainability and demand for energy-efficient solutions.
- Continuous innovation in LED design for industrial, commercial, and residential applications.
- Government incentives and international clean energy initiatives.
